2024年1月19日发(作者:)
v8引擎使用方法
摘要:
1.V8引擎简介
2.V8引擎的安装与配置
3.V8引擎的使用方法
4.V8引擎的优化与调试
5.总结与建议
正文:
v8引擎是一款高性能的javascript引擎,由Google开发,广泛应用于Chrome浏览器和环境中。本文将详细介绍v8引擎的使用方法,帮助你更好地掌握这款强大的引擎。
一、V8引擎简介
V8引擎是一款开源的、基于单线程的javascript引擎。它采用了创新的异步执行技术,能够在单个线程中并行执行多个javascript任务,提高了程序的运行效率。此外,V8引擎还具有内存管理高效、垃圾回收快速等特点,使得它在处理大型javascript应用程序时表现出色。
二、V8引擎的安装与配置
1.安装:在Chrome浏览器中,v8引擎已经默认启用。你可以在设置中检查当前使用的引擎版本。
2.配置:在环境中,可以通过npm安装v8引擎的版本控制工具,如nvm或n,方便在不同项目之间切换引擎版本。
三、V8引擎的使用方法
1.基本语法:与传统javascript引擎相比,v8引擎的语法并无太大差异。你可以按照现有javascript知识进行编程。
2.异步编程:v8引擎擅长处理异步任务,可以使用Promise、async/await等语法进行异步编程。
Workers:在Chrome浏览器中,可以使用Web Workers技术在后台线程中运行javascript代码,减轻主线程的负担。
四、V8引擎的优化与调试
1.性能优化:针对v8引擎的特点,可以采用如事件驱动、模块化、代码分割等优化策略。
2.调试:使用Chrome浏览器的开发者工具或的调试工具进行代码调试。
五、总结与建议
V8引擎凭借其高性能和优秀的内存管理,成为了现代前端开发的基石。掌握v8引擎的使用方法,可以提高你的编程效率,使你的项目在性能上更上一层楼。在日常开发中,要注意合理利用v8引擎的特点,如异步编程、性能优化等,以充分发挥其潜力。


发布评论